Who It's For
The set is well suited to tire shops, mobile mechanics and experienced DIYers who regularly remove and install wheels and want a low-effort way to avoid over-torquing. It is particularly useful where repetitive wheel work increases the risk of stripped nuts or damaged studs and a simple mechanical solution is preferred over electronic torque tools.
Those who should look elsewhere include users who require exact torque to the single ft-lb or need adjustable torque values; this set provides preset ranges rather than precise single-value torque calibration. Also buyers who rarely work on wheels may find a single calibrated torque wrench more versatile.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can these be used with an impact wrench?
Yes, they are compatible with 1/2' drive impact wrenches and are designed to limit torque when used in that way.
Do the bars rust easily?
No, the set uses a rust-resistant coating and CR-MO construction to resist corrosion in harsh environments.
Are torque values adjustable?
No, the bars use preset torque limiting ranges and are not adjustable; for exact ft-lb settings a calibrated torque wrench is recommended.
